HS Code for Public works equipment
Public works equipment is classified under HS code 8479.10. This classification is part of Chapter 84, which deals with nuclear reactors, boilers, machinery, and mechanical appliances. Heading 84.79 is a "residual" heading for machines and mechanical appliances having individual functions, not specified or included elsewhere in Chapter 84. Subheading 8479.10 specifically targets machinery for public works, building, or the like. This includes a variety of specialized mechanical devices used in infrastructure projects that do not fit into more specific categories like earth-moving (84.29) or lifting (84.25). The classification is based on the machine's primary function being related to construction or maintenance of public infrastructure, such as roads or bridges, provided the machine does not have a more specific heading elsewhere in the nomenclature. This code is essential for identifying specialized civil engineering tools that are neither simple hand tools nor heavy earth-moving vehicles.
Products Included
- Concrete vibrators and spreaders
- Asphalt and bitumen distributors
- Road sweepers (mechanical)
- Gravel spreaders and mortar sprayers
- Small road rollers (non-self-propelled)
Common Misclassification
Public works equipment is often misclassified under 8429.51 (front-end shovel loaders) or 8430.50 (other self-propelled earth-moving machinery). The distinction lies in whether the machine is primarily for moving earth or for specific building/public works tasks like spreading material or finishing surfaces. Additionally, simple hand tools are classified in Chapter 82, not 8479.

Does this include excavators?
No, excavators are specifically classified under heading 84.29 as self-propelled earth-moving machinery.

Is the HS code for Public works equipment the same in all countries?
The base HS code 847910 for Public works equipment is internationally standardized for the first 6 digits across 200+ countries. Individual countries may add additional digits for national tariff lines and specific classifications.
